Biography

Professor Rolf Henke joined the Executive Board of the German Aerospace Center – Division aeronautics in 2010. Since November 2020, he has been the Representative Aviation of the Executive Board. He is also Professor of Aeronautics and Astronautics at the Technical University of Rhineland Westphalia in Aachen, where he formerly acted as head of the Institute of Aerospace Technology.

In addition to his academic responsibilities, Professor Henke worked at MBB (Messerschmitt-Bölkow-Blohm, now Airbus Operations) for 20 years. He has been president of the German Society for Aeronautics and Astronautics (DGLR) since 2013. Furthermore, Professor Henke actively participates in European aviation research initiatives. He was involved in drafting "Flightpath 2050", the European vision for aviation. Additionally, Professor Henke participates in ACARE, the Advisory Council for Aviation Research and Innovation in Europe, having been chair and currently being co-chair.
